Output e95806426b763d28af5f1635994210161aea88db9519a65be2985e4c5a1d4188:25

value
184946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1b75658318e4b04bdbdadda5a0756c1499c0222 OP_EQUAL
address
3GS6Lvg2Wd8VoMp8X2cePh16oc5uXqfwAf
transaction
e95806426b763d28af5f1635994210161aea88db9519a65be2985e4c5a1d4188